Transforming Apparel: The Strategic Impact of ERP Built for the Industry
The apparel industry is unlike any other. Few sectors face such a relentless pace of change—shaped by shifting consumer behaviour, fast-fashion cycles, and the constant tension between creativity and commerciality. On top of this, companies must navigate globalised supply chains, increasingly complex SKUs (size, colour, fit, and seasonal variations), and the dual demands of both B2B and B2C sales models.
For many apparel businesses, this creates a unique operational paradox: while creativity thrives on flexibility and innovation, operations demand consistency, structure, and visibility. Too often, generic ERP systems are stretched beyond their limits, leaving teams reliant on workarounds, spreadsheets, and manual processes that slow down decision-making and increase risk.
This is why industry leaders should be asking: what if operational systems were designed specifically for the apparel sector? What would it mean to replace generic tools with solutions that reflect the realities of fashion and footwear—where speed-to-market, supply chain oversight, and data-driven agility are now critical to long-term success?
